From the glorious roar as it explodes into life to the rich purr emitted at rest by its charismatic 4.0 litre V8 engine, the Bentley Continental GT V8 S represents an experience all of its own.

This powerful new member of the Continental range takes Bentley’s advanced V8 platform and pushes it even further. The result: marked improvements in performance alongside a sleeker, more sporting appearance.

The Beluga lower body styling and new-design 20” wheels are a clear statement of intent. Recalibrated engine, revised stability control and an uprated chassis complete the picture, delivering the kind of thrilling drive you expect from a sports car with Bentley’s racing DNA.

With enough space inside to comfortably seat four adults and a boot that can accommodate all your luggage, the Continental GT V8 S remains the definitive British grand tourer. But it’s the fearsome combination of limitless power and exhilarating handling of this luxury coupé that gives it the edge.

Beneath the bonnet of the new Continental GT V8 S beats a monstrous heart: a 4 litre, twin-turbocharged V8 engine, with the power to generate 521 bhp (389 kW / 528 PS @ 6,000 rpm).  At 1700 RPM the Continental GT V8 S generates 680 Newton metres of torque – even more than the 660 Nm achieved by its sibling, the Continental ContinentalGT V8. From a standing start the GT V8 S will reach 60 miles per hour in 4.3 seconds, before climbing all the way to its top speed of 192mph (309 km/h).
